/// Action Wrapper
/// There is a `call_tcx_api` method in tcx which act as a endpoint like RPC. It accepts a `TcxAction` param which method field is
/// the real action and param field is the real param of that method.
/// When an error occurred, the `call_tcx_api` will return a `Response` which isSuccess field be false and error field is the reason
/// which cause the error.
#[allow(clippy::derive_partial_eq_without_eq)]
#[derive(Clone, PartialEq, ::prost::Message)]
pub struct TcxAction {
#[prost(string, tag = "1")]
pub method: ::prost::alloc::string::String,
#[prost(message, optional, tag = "2")]
pub param: ::core::option::Option<::prost_types::Any>,
}
/// A common response when error occurred.
#[allow(clippy::derive_partial_eq_without_eq)]
#[derive(Clone, PartialEq, ::prost::Message)]
pub struct GeneralResult {
#[prost(bool, tag = "1")]
pub is_success: bool,
#[prost(string, tag = "2")]
pub error: ::prost::alloc::string::String,
}
